About MD in Psychiatry

The MD in Psychiatry at Nepal Medical College is a three-year postgraduate medical program affiliated with Kathmandu University. The specialty focuses on the evaluation, di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of mental, emotional, and behavioral disorders.

Nepal Medical College conducts postgraduate medical education at Attarkhel, Jorpati, Kathmandu. Psychiatry is included among its postgraduate MD/MS specialties, and Nepal Medical College Teaching Hospital has psychiatric services within its wider clinical environment.

About MD in Psychiatry

MD in Psychiatry is a postgraduate medical specialty concerned with mental health and psychiatric disorders. Its clinical scope includes the assessment, di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of mental, emotional, and behavioral conditions.

The program follows undergraduate medical education and requires candidates to enter with an MBBS or equivalent qualification. At Nepal Medical College, Psychiatry forms part of the broader postgraduate MD/MS academic structure, which combines academic instruction with practical clinical experience.

Course Duration

The MD in Psychiatry program under Kathmandu University has a duration of three years.

Academic progression, examinations, and degree completion follow the applicable Kathmandu University rules and regulations.

Eligibility

Candidates applying for MD in Psychiatry must meet the postgraduate medical eligibility requirements.

The requirements include:

  • MBBS or equivalent from an institution recognized by the Government of Nepal

  • Registration with the Nepal Medical Council

  • Registration with the respective medical council for foreign candidates

  • One year of experience

  • A minimum of 50% in the entrance examination conducted by the Medical Education Commission to become eligible for the merit list

MECEE-PG Entrance and Admission

Admission is conducted through the Medical Education Commission under the postgraduate medical education framework.

Candidates must appear in MECEE-PG and participate in the applicable MEC merit and seat-allocation process. Nepal Medical College does not operate an independent postgraduate admission process outside this centralized framework.

The admission pathway includes:

  • Meeting the MBBS and professional registration requirements

  • Completing the required experience

  • Appearing in MECEE-PG

  • Meeting the prescribed entrance qualification

  • Participating in MEC seat allocation

  • Completing admission after allocation

MECEE-PG Examination Format

The postgraduate entrance examination uses single-best-response multiple-choice questions.

  • Number of questions: 200

  • Options per question: Four

  • Recall, Understanding and Application ratio: 30:50:20

  • Duration: 3 hours

  • Psychiatry weightage: 7 marks

The examination also covers Medicine, Surgery, Obstetrics and Gynecology, Pediatrics, Orthopedics, ENT, Ophthalmology, Anaesthesiology, Radiology, Dermatology, basic medical sciences, Community Medicine and Research Methodology, Forensic Medicine, and mandatory professional topics.

Clinical Learning Environment

Nepal Medical College Teaching Hospital includes Psychiatry among its clinical departments. The hospital also provides psychiatric services and EEG services within a multidisciplinary setting that includes medicine, emergency care, pediatrics, dermatology, critical care, laboratory services, and diagnostic departments.

This environment connects postgraduate psychiatric education with the broader hospital system in which patients may require assessment and care involving more than one medical specialty.

Degree and Professional Registration

Kathmandu University awards the postgraduate degree after successful completion of the applicable academic, clinical, and examination requirements.

Applicants enter the program with registration from the Nepal Medical Council. Professional medical practice remains subject to the council requirements applicable after postgraduate study.
